#0c1728 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0c1728 is composed of 4.7% red, 9%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70% cyan, 42.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 84.3% black. It has a hue angle of 216.4 degrees, a saturation of 53.8% and a lightness of 10.2%. #0c1728 color hex could be obtained by blending #182e50 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

● #0c1728 color description : Very dark (mostly black) blue.
#0c1728 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0c1728 has RGB values of R:12, G:23,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0.43, Y:0, K:0.84. Its decimal value is 792360.

Shades and Tints of #0c1728
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03060a is the darkest color, while #fafb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#0c1728
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#181a1c is the less saturated color, while #001434 is the most saturated one.
